    Arad is a mid-size city in the west of Romania.

    Arad is a mid-size city in the west of Romania. The longer the more, Western influences become more and more visible. A wide variety of Western banking and insurance companies, foodstores that cater to almost every wish, car dealers from Skoda to Jaguar, excellent shopping of every kind - from the modern and exquisite Atrium Mall to the local "Jackson" market, excellent restaurants offering a wide-range of local and international food, and, last but definitely not least, a couple of nice sights, such as the town hall, the Biserica Franciscana, surrounded by the River Mures, and the massive "Holy Trinity" cathedral, a landmark in the town, are musts when stopping in Arad. During the warm days of summer, parks, promenades, open bars and restaurants invite you for a snack or a delicious dinner and if temperatures are getting too hot, you will find cooling at "The Strand" a huge public swimming pool. With the city further renovating old buildings, bringing them back to full glory and with busses and trams connecting the most important parts of town, getting around is easy and cheap ... and, Timisoara, the country's third biggest city, with its beautiful historical town, is just half an hour drive away. Go, visit Arad, it is the perfect stop while travelling from Western Europe towards the Black Sea.
